Iiingenelo kunye nokungalungi kwebheyari ephambili yamandla omoya
TIintlobo eziphambili zeebheringi ze-spindle ezisetyenziselwa ii-turbine zomoya ze-megawatt yi-design ye-bearing bearing enamachaphaza ama-3 kunye ne-2-point bearing bearing design,Nceda ujonge oku kungezantsiaiingenelo kunye nokungalungi kwe-thibhereyitha ye-eseisakhiwo
Iibheringi zerola ezingqukuva + iibheringi zerola ezingqukuva
Iingenelo zezokuba akukho mthwalo okanye umthwalo ophantsi osebenza kwibhokisi yegiya, ngelixa kuxhomekeke kwingalo yokujika ukuze imelane nokuguquguquka okuncinci, kwaye ukuhlanganiswa kulula kakhulu.
Iingxaki zezi zilandelayo:
1) Indawo yokungena kwe-axial inkulu kakhulu, kwaye indawo yehabhu kwicala le-axial ayilunganga;
2) Akukho mthwalo ubekwe kwangaphambili kwibheriya ephambili, kwaye ukufuduka kwe-axial kukhulu emva kokulayisha, kwaye kwangaxeshanye, ngenxa yokungabikho komthwalo obekwe kwangaphambili, i-roller enye ayinakujikeleza, nto leyo ekhokelela ekutyibilikeni, nto leyo eya kuvelisa umthwalo omkhulu kakhulu kwaye ichaphazele ubomi bebheriya;
3) Ubungakanani bomngxuma buncinci, kwaye impembelelo yomthwalo kumngxuma mkhulu.
Iibheringi zerola ezijikelezayo + iibheringi zerola ezisilinda
Iingenelo zale ndlela yokwakha iibheringi kukuba akukho mthwalo okanye umthwalo ophantsi osebenza kwibhokisi yegiya, ngelixa uxhomekeke kwingalo ye-torsion ukumelana nokuguquguquka okuncinci, kwaye ukuhlanganiswa kulula kakhulu.
Iiingxaki zezi zilandelayo:
1) Indawo yokungena kwe-axial inkulu kakhulu, kwaye indawo yehabhu kwicala le-axial ayilunganga;
2) Akukho mthwalo ubekwe kwangaphambili kwibheriya ephambili, kwaye ukufuduka kwe-axial kukhulu emva kokulayisha, kwaye kwangaxeshanye, ngenxa yokungabikho komthwalo obekwe kwangaphambili, i-roller enye ayinakujikeleza, nto leyo ekhokelela ekutyibilikeni, nto leyo eya kuvelisa umthwalo omkhulu kakhulu kwaye ichaphazele ubomi bebheriya;
3) Ubungakanani befreyimu ephambili bukhulu okanye buqulathe iindawo ezininzi, nto leyo ebangela ukuba ixabiso lefreyimu ephambili libe phezulu kwaye ukucutshungulwa kube nzima ngakumbi;
4) Ngenxa yokuba iibheringi ze-roller ezisilinda zinovelwano kwi-coaxiality kunye nokuphambuka okunxulumeneyo kweeringi zangaphakathi nezangaphandle, azilungelelani kakuhle kuyilo okanye ekuhlanganisweni kwazo.
Kule meko, ukucaciswa kwe-radial kwee-spherical roller bearings kuya kukhokelela ekonakaleni kwee-cylindrical rollers;
5) Ngenxa yobukhulu obuncinci bomngxuma kunye nebheyari, ukuqina kwenkqubo yokufunxa kuphantsi kakhulu, kwaye umthwalo unempembelelo enkulu kumngxuma.
Iibheringi zerola eziphindwe kabini ezixineneyo + iibheringi zerola ezisilinda
Iingenelo eziphambili zale sakhiwo sokuthwala zezi:
1) Akukho ndawo ivulelekileyo, kwaye indawo ebekwe kuyo ingcono;
2) Umthamo wokuthwala ungandiswa ngokwandisa umgama phakathi kweebheringi, kwaye uluhlu olufanelekileyo lweebheringi lukhulu;
3) Ububanzi bomngxuma kunye nebheyari buncinci, kwaye ixabiso liphantsi;
4) Ngenxa yokususwa kwe-axial clearance, ukuqina kwenkqubo ye-shaft kuphezulu kakhulu, kwaye umthwalo oguqukayo awunampembelelo ingako kuyo.
